For most FortiGate models if you do not change the heartbeat device configuration, 
you would isolate the HA interfaces of all of the cluster units by connecting them all to 
the same switch. If the cluster consists of two FortiGate units you can connect the 
heartbeat device interfaces directly using a crossover cable.
HA heartbeat and data traffic are supported on the same FortiGate interface. In 
NAT/Route mode, if you decide to use the heartbeat device interfaces for processing 
network traffic or for a management connection, you can assign the interface any IP 
address. This IP address does not affect the heartbeat traffic. In Transparent mode, 
you can connect the interface to your network.
Monitor priorities
Monitor priorities and link failover is not supported for the internal interface.
Enable or disable monitoring a FortiGate interface to verify that the interface is 
functioning properly and connected to its network. If a monitored interface fails or is 
disconnected from its network the interface leaves the cluster. The cluster reroutes 
the traffic being processed by that interface to the same interface of another cluster 
unit in the cluster that still has a connection to the network. This other cluster unit 
becomes the new primary cluster unit.
If you can re-establish traffic flow through the interface (for example, if you re-connect 
a disconnected network cable) the interface rejoins the cluster. If Override Master is 
enabled for this FortiGate unit (see 
), this FortiGate unit 
becomes the primary unit in the cluster again.
Increase the priority of interfaces connected to higher priority networks or networks 
with more traffic. The monitor priority range is 0 to 512.
If a high priority interface on the primary cluster unit fails, one of the other units in the 
cluster becomes the new primary unit to provide better service to the high priority 
network. 
If a low priority interface fails on one cluster unit and a high priority interface fails on 
another cluster unit, a unit in the cluster with a working connection to the high priority 
interface would, if it becomes necessary to negotiate a new primary unit, be selected 
instead of a unit with a working connection to the low priority interface.
Note: Only monitor interfaces that are connected to networks.
Note: You can monitor physical interfaces, but not VLAN subinterfaces.
